North Tolsta comes out at 41/100 on the 6 categories we can score here. Measured against other towns, bills stands out most: 67/100 where the typical UK town scores 47/100. Broadband falls furthest short: 10/100 where the typical UK town reaches 60/100.

That makes it the 2nd highest-scoring of the 10 places in the HS2 postcode district. It scores 11 points above the HS2 postcode district as a whole, which averages 30/100. That is 9 points below the national benchmark of 50, the middle half of all UK towns and villages. Wider context for the surrounding area: HS2 postcode district.

Crime is scored from the last 12 months of police street-level data. Police Scotland does not publish this, and there is no Scottish equivalent of the Police UK open data service, so crime has been left out of the score for this area. This is a gap in published data, not a sign of low crime.

Sold-price data isn't available for North Tolsta. HM Land Registry's Price Paid dataset covers England and Wales only. Scottish sales are recorded separately by Registers of Scotland, which we don't yet include. This is a gap in the data we hold, not a sign of an inactive market.
